Ashli is a lifelong resident of the 30th District. Beginning her education in Federal Way Public Schools, she was a student at Rainier View Elementary School, Illahee Middle School, and, later, she attended Sequoyah Middle School in its inaugural year. Ashli and her family are parishioners of St. Vincent de Paul Parish in Federal Way. Accordingly, she and her three younger siblings all attended Bellarmine Preparatory School where they were able to receive an academically challenging and faith enriching education. After graduating from Bellarmine in 2011, Ashli went on to Boston University where she ran both division-one cross country and track, and double majored in international relations and political science. Upon graduating from Boston University’s Frederick S. Pardee School of Global Studies in 2015, she became the first in her family to graduate from college with a bachelor’s degree.Ashli’s passion for political activism and community outreach began in 2015 when she campaigned in former State Representative Teri Hickel’s special election race against Democrat Carol Gregory. After helping Teri secure her seat in the Legislature, Ashli went on to work for the Washington State Republican Party where she worked her way up through several positions over three years. First, as finance assistant. Then, as communications director. And, finally, as finance director. In 2018, Ashli left the WSRP to fulfill her childhood dream of becoming a lawyer by starting law school at Seattle University School of Law. When COVID-19 shut down Washington State in March 2020, and domestic violence cases increased as a result, Ashli became one of the founding legal interns in Seattle University’s Domestic Violence Pop-Up Clinic. In this role, she assisted survivors of domestic violence in filing for, and obtaining, domestic violence protection orders. Ashli was admitted to the Washington State Bar in December 2021. Her legal practice focuses on trust and estate litigation and real estate and business transactions.In her free time, Ashli enjoys running her favorite routes throughout the 30th District, and spending quality time with her boyfriend, parents, siblings, and two goldendoodles, Bennett and Archie.
